The Vital Role of Nutrition in Holistic Health

Nutrition plays a vital role in holistic health, encompassing physical, mental, and emotional well-being. The food we eat provides the building blocks for our bodies to function optimally, impacting our overall health and vitality. A holistic approach to nutrition considers not only the caloric content of food but also its quality and nutrient density.

Whole, unprocessed foods rich in essential nutrients such as vitamins, minerals, antioxidants, and fiber support the body’s natural detoxification processes, boost the immune system, and reduce inflammation. By focusing on a balanced diet comprising a variety of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ats, individuals can nourish their bodies and promote overall wellness.

In addition to physical health, nutrition also influences mental and emotional well-being. Nutrient deficiencies have been linked to mood disorders, cognitive decline, and stress. Adopting a nutrient-dense diet can support mental clarity, emotional stability, and overall mental health, contributing to a holistic approach to wellness.

Mindfulness: A Cornerstone of Holistic Health

Mindfulness is a cornerstone of holistic health, encompassing the practice of being present in the moment and fully engaged with our thoughts, feelings, and environment. It involves paying attention to our experiences without judgment, allowing us to cultivate self-awareness and a deeper understanding of ourselves.

By incorporating mindfulness into our daily lives, we can reduce stress, anxiety, and depression, improve our mental clarity and focus, and enhance our overall well-being. Mindfulness practices such as meditation, deep breathing, and mindful movement can help us reconnect with our bodies and minds, promoting a sense of balance and inner peace.

Research has shown that mindfulness can have a positive impact on various aspects of health, including heart health, immune function, and chronic pain management. It can also support emotional regulation and resilience in the face of life’s challenges, making it a valuable tool for promoting holistic health and wellness.

Choosing the Right Holistic Health Practitioner: A Guide

Choosing the right holistic health practitioner is a crucial decision that can greatly impact your overall well-being. When seeking out a holistic health practitioner, it’s essential to consider a few key factors to ensure you find the right fit for your needs.

First and foremost, do your research. Look into the practitioner’s background, training, and experience. Make sure they are properly certified and have a good reputation in the field. Additionally, consider their approach to holistic health. Each practitioner may have a different philosophy or specialization, so find one whose approach aligns with your beliefs and goals.

Next, consider the location and convenience of the practitioner. Is their office easily accessible to you? Will the appointment times work with your schedule?

Finally, trust your instincts. It’s important to feel comfortable and supported by your holistic health practitioner. Make sure you have good communication with them and feel that they are truly listening to your concerns and working with you to improve your health and well-being.
